Reset Storage Array Battery Install Date
This command resets the age of the batteries in a storage array to zero days.
You can reset the batteries for an entire storage array or the battery in a
specific RAID controller module.
Syntax
reset storageArray batteryInstallDate controller=
(0 | 1)
Parameters
NOTE:
If you do not specify a RAID controller module, the age is reset for the
storage array battery or both RAID controller module batteries. If you specify a
RAID controller module, then the age for only that RAID controller module battery is
reset.
Reset Storage Array iSCSI Baseline
This command resets the iSCI baseline for the storage array to 0.
Syntax
reset storageArray iscsiStatsBaseline
